Deviated Septum and a Nose Job
Many patients with a deviated septum combine a nose job or rhinoplasty with a septoplasty. A septoplasty is a surgical procedure that corrects a deviated nasal septum. It straightens and repositions the bone and cartilage that separates your two nostrils. This allows for better breathing, helps with nose bleeds and alleviates pain.
Once the alignment of your septum is corrected, it improves airflow through your nose. During the recovery period after a nose job, swelling may cause a slight change to your voice, but once the swelling is reduced, voice quality will return. The risk that one’s singing voice will change is very small.

Surgical Risks
As with any surgery, there are risks. Patients should always weigh the benefits against the risks before making a decision. This is especially true with any cosmetic or elective surgeries.
